What You’ll Do:
Deliver compassionate, patient-centered care in a hospice setting, collaborating with an interdisciplinary team dedicated to comfort, dignity, and quality of life
Provide hands-on care to patients, assisting with activities of daily living (ADLs) while observing and reporting changes in condition to support comfort and quality of life
Support and guide patients and caregivers by reinforcing the care plan, offering emotional support, and helping them understand what to expect during the hospice journey
Respond promptly to patient needs with empathy and attentiveness and accurately document care provided in the EMR
Work independently, but never alone
Travel to patient homes within assigned territory
